Associated Resources In Psychology, Pa is a mental health clinic (Psychologist - Counseling) in Roseville, Minnesota. The current practice location for Associated Resources In Psychology, Pa is 2233 Hamline Ave N, Suite 110, Roseville, Minnesota. For appointments, you can reach them via phone at (651) 483-2522. The mailing address for Associated Resources In Psychology, Pa is 2233 Hamline Ave N, Suite 110, Roseville, Minnesota and phone number is (651) 483-2522.

Associated Resources In Psychology, Pa is licensed to practice in Minnesota (license number LP0502) and its NPI number is 1144306614. This medical practice does not participate in medicare program and thus may not accept your medicare insurance. You may check if they accept your insurance at (651) 483-2522.

Overall death rate for patients developed complications during hospitalization fell by 23%: AHRQ

Fewer hospital patients died from complications in their health care between 2001 and 2006, but Asians/Pacific Islanders and Hispanics were less likely to survive than either whites or blacks, according to the latest News and Numbers from the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ality.
